The Grand Canyon Occupies a Large Portion of the Southwestern United States. The Grand Canyon is an immense canal that is dissected by the Colorado River. It stretches up to 18 miles wide, over 270 miles long, and with a maximum depth of 6,093 feet. Grand Canyon National Park – Thanksgiving Day Sunset 2024.

WebThe three main rock layer sets in the Grand Canyon are grouped based on position and common composition and 1) Metamorphic basement rocks, 2) The Precambrian Grand Canyon Supergroup, and 3) Paleozoic strata. These three main sets of rocks were first described by the explorer and scientist John Wesley Powell during his expeditions of the …

WebJul 19, 2012 · Blyde River Canyon, Mpumalanga, South Africa. Blyde River Canyon is 16 miles long and 2,500 feet deep, the second largest canyon in Africa. 9. Palo Duro Canyon, near Amarillo, Texas, US. The second largest canyon in the United States, the “Grand Canyon of Texas” is 120 miles long with depths up to 997 feet.
